Dr. Hilkovitz shares what the prediabetes stage is.
Dr. Hilkovitz:
Prediabetes is the stage when you have obesity, a family history of diabetes, a big waistline, high cholesterol, and high blood pressure, but your blood sugar has not yet reached diabetic levels which would be over 125 fasting and I think, over 160 after a meal, but the American Diabetes Association insists on a blood sugar above 200 after meal to diagnose diabetes, and most of us disagree with that. We think it should be set lower.
